Water Leak Detection: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for minor overflows, but professional help is recommended for larger areas or complex repairs.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ary for flooded basements, as DIY can lead to further damage and safety risks.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ary for wet drywall, as DIY can lead to mold growth and further damage. |
| Leaky pipe under sink | Yes | No | DIY is fine for minor leaky pipes, but professional help is recommended for larger areas or complex repairs. |
| Flooding from nearby creek |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ary for flooding from nearby creeks, as DIY can lead to further damage and safety risks. |
| Water damage from appliance malfunction |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ary for water damage from appliance malfunctions, as DIY can lead to further damage and safety risks. |

Water Leak Detection Cost In The 98314 Area
The cost of water leak detection in the 98314 area can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. But, with our free estimates and transparency in pricing you can trust that we’ll get the job done right at a fair price.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The cost of emergency water extraction varies depending on the size of the affected area and the amount of standing water. |
| Structural Drying Process | $2,000 – $5,000 | The cost of structural drying varies depending on the size of the affected area and the complexity of the repair. |
| Mold Detection and Monitoring | $1,000 – $3,000 | The cost of mold detection and monitoring varies depending on the size of the affected area and the complexity of the repair.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$4,000 | The cost of sewage cleanup varies depending on the size of the affected area and the complexity of the repair.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$3,000 – $6,000 | The cost of basement flood recovery varies depending on the size of the affected area and the complexity of the repair. |
| Water Damage Restoration | $2,500 – $5,500 | The cost of water damage restoration varies depending on the size of the affected area and the complexity of the repair. |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, but we offer free estimates to ensure you get the best deal.
